The land of Vulnia was lit up by the bright morning sun and the townspeople were setting up their shops along the road. Talus walked between the shops, brooding about what to buy.

He had just finished his tenth job this week and his back was aching. He slid his hand over the items, unsure about what to buy. He didn’t have much money with him since he had just payed off his debt and estimated that he could buy one item only.

“Jeez… maybe I should just save up…” he wanted to save up but he was afraid of robbers. Robbers were common in the land of Vulnia since most people were poor and did not have an education. The chances of you getting robbed while in Vulnia were extremely high so merchants and nobles usually stayed out of Vulnia. This was the reason Vulnia stayed in it’s poor and miserable state.

He walked towards an alleyway between two shops with the handle of his sword in his hand. “Maybe I’ll have better luck in the black market.” he muttered to himself. The black market was known to all the townsfolk as a place for cheap and illegal goods. However, many people would be attacked before they even reached the black market. Many thugs hung out at the black market since the black market was a place that didn’t have guards patrolling in it.

“I smell a fat purse a mile away! Hand over your money and perhaps I can allow you to get to your destination safe and sound!” A voice suddenly rang out. Talus looked around him and saw a man surrounded by people with all sorts of weapons. A fat man stood outside the circle with a neat white suit on. “Mi-milord h-how much do you n-need?” The man was stammering and a single emotion was written on his face: fear.

“One hundred and fifty dezas and I’ll let you go.” The fat man chuckled.

“O-of course milord!”

Talus couldn’t stand by the sidelines and watch anymore. One hundred and fifty dezas was a whole year’s worth of salary in Vulnia! “Oi! Fat guy! Gimme all your money!” Talus bellowed. He knew talking most certainly wouldn’t work and the only choice left would be fighting.

Talus drew his sword from his scabbard and pointed it directly at them. “YOU BASTARD! GET HIM!” As soon as he said that, the people surrounding the man charged towards Talus.
